Web11 mei 2024 · Thanks to his masterful use of line and color, for many The Dance is seen as the highlight of Matisse's career and a turning point in modern art. Blue Nudes (1952) After being diagnosed with stomach cancer in 1941, Matisse was left confined to a chair. But he never let this obstacle stand in the way of his creativity. Henri Matisse was a French painter and sculptor, who was one of the pioneers of the Fauvist movement. He is considered one of the most important artists of the 20th century. Matisse is best known for his paintings in which he used bright colors and …

Henri Émile Benoît Matisse (December 31, 1869 – November 3, 1954) is considered one of the most influential painters of the 20th century, and one of the leading Modernists. Known for his use of vibrant colors and simple forms, Matisse helped to usher in a new approach to art. korthia awaits wowWeb16 jan. 2024 · Henri Matisse (1869-1954) was one of the most influential French artists in history.
